Trump Simply Silenced the Web’s Alpha Bros Over Iran

It was the sort of second that often lights up the manosphere.

U.S. bombs fell on Iran on June 21 in a dramatic army operation named “Operation Midnight Hammer” that destroyed three main nuclear websites: Fordow, Natanz, and Isfahan. President Donald Trump, in a televised deal with, warned that the USA may strike once more if Iran didn’t conform to a diplomatic answer. In Iran, Overseas Minister Abbas Araghchi condemned the strikes throughout a press convention with reporters in Istanbul, saying: “My nation has been below assault, below aggression, and we have now to reply based mostly on our professional proper of self-defense.”

And but… silence.

Not a phrase from the loudest voices within the on-line male influencer sphere, the manosphere. The digital brotherhood that often has a take for each cultural second all of the sudden had nothing to say. The loudest MAGA influencers, identified for outlining masculinity on-line by means of warfare metaphors, grindset sermons, and political firebombs, logged off.

The manosphere isn’t a single motion. It’s a chaotic constellation of figures from neoconservatives and libertarians to pro-Israel influencers, non-interventionist Christians, and Muslim masculinists. Collectively, they make up an unlimited on-line ecosystem that has formed how tens of millions of males, particularly younger ones, speak about politics, warfare, id, and masculinity.

When Israel first bombed Iran on June 12, many manosphere figures had been already at war digitally over whether or not the U.S. ought to get entangled. Some like Ben Shapiro referred to as for full-throated U.S. help for Israel. Others, like Matt Walsh, had been firmly towards American army intervention, citing Trump’s 2024 marketing campaign promise to keep away from international wars.

The inner feud spilled throughout timelines. Within the week that adopted, Walsh was attacked by his personal followers for being insufficiently hawkish.

“Matt Walsh will turn into woke proper,” one consumer posted on X, previously Twitter. “I don’t relish that reality, as a result of I like Matt, and he’s been certainly one of my favourite conservative commentators for years.”

Walsh fired again: “This witch hunt is insane. You guys have misplaced your damned minds. Every part I’m saying about international coverage proper now’s what I’ve been saying for so long as I’ve had a platform. So if me remaining extremely constant on the problems, and constant to my buddies, makes me ‘woke proper,’ so be it.”

Two days later, the bombs dropped. And the discourse… evaporated.

What adopted wasn’t unity. It was absence.

The identical influencers who had crammed feeds with infographics, sizzling takes, and theological justifications for or towards warfare all of the sudden stopped posting.

It was particularly placing given the stakes. A U.S. president had taken the nation into an undeclared battle that might widen right into a regional warfare or worse. For a gaggle that presents itself as truth-tellers and alpha defenders of Western values, their silence regarded much less like stoicism and extra like paralysis.

Charlie Kirk, founding father of Turning Level USA and an in depth Trump ally, had warned days earlier that army motion would alienate the younger male voters who powered Trump’s comeback. However when the strikes occurred, Kirk flipped.

“With the burden of the world on his shoulders, President Trump acted for the betterment of humanity,” Kirk posted on June 21. “For the subsequent few hours, spare us the arm chair quarterbacking and as an alternative belief our Commander in Chief.”

Nonetheless, he hedged, making an attempt to not lose followers who opposed intervention.

“Rejoicing as a result of we dropped a bomb ought to be met with humility. Dooming ought to be met with cautionary optimism. The world will not be over. Our greatest days are forward.”

Others went quiet altogether. Patrick Guess-David, an Iranian-American entrepreneur who typically criticizes the Ayatollah regime, merely wrote “Attention-grabbing” below Trump’s Reality Social publish.

Even Ben Shapiro, who has constructed a profession supporting Israeli safety pursuits, didn’t instantly weigh in.

Only some broke the silence. Konstantin Kisin, a British commentator aligned with the pro-Israel proper, supported the bombings. “Sure, I’m glad the Islamic Revolutionary regime is not going to get nuclear weapons,” he posted.

However within the anti-war camp, the pushback was scarce aside from Dave Smith, a libertarian comic and common on The Joe Rogan Expertise, who didn’t mince phrases.

“Donald Trump has now launched an unlawful warfare of aggression towards Iran. The chance of an absolute disaster could be very excessive and the advantages are non-existent,” Smith wrote. “Worst of all, he did it on behalf of a international authorities towards a rustic which posed no menace to us.”

It is a disaster of id.

The manosphere has spent years turning power, dominance, and ethical readability right into a model. However Trump’s Iran strike broke their body. For as soon as, the final word alpha male, Trump himself, compelled his on-line followers into an ethical nook. Select the chief, or select the precept.

Many selected silence.

The fallout from “Operation Midnight Hammer” remains to be unfolding. However the long-term harm might already be executed. Trump might have reminded his base who’s boss. However in doing so, he might have damaged the phantasm that the alpha influencers ever stood for something greater than energy itself.
